Morgan Stanley's Staking ETFs Shift Crypto Pricing From Speculation to Yield

Woofun AI reports that the integration of native staking mechanisms into strictly regulated spot ETF structures represents a fundamental departure from passive price-tracking models, a milestone achieved when NYSE Arca officially approved the spot SOL and Ethereum ETFs submitted by Morgan Stanley on July 24, 2026. This regulatory clearance constitutes a dual breakthrough for professional institutional investors: it marks the first instance of a top Wall Street investment bank issuing an ETF for a crypto asset other than Bitcoin, and simultaneously signifies the first time U.

S. regulators have permitted large-scale native staking mechanisms of public chains to be fully embedded within these financial instruments. Leveraging its existing experience managing a spot Bitcoin ETF (MSBT) with approximately $392 million in assets under management, Morgan Stanley has effectively equipped these digital assets with fixed-income elements, challenging the prevailing market paradigm.

The core question emerging from this product launch concerns the structural alteration of pricing frameworks when crypto ETFs transform from passive tools into active income-generating assets. Given that the total size of U.S. spot Bitcoin ETFs currently stands at $80.9 billion, the introduction of these two new vehicles by Morgan Stanley forces a reevaluation of how institutional capital allocates resources. The shift suggests that diversified asset allocations are no longer merely a theoretical preference but a practical necessity as the definition of crypto assets evolves. This transition raises critical inquiries about how existing pricing structures will adapt to accommodate assets that produce steady cash flows rather than relying solely on speculative appreciation.

In terms of fee structure, Morgan Stanley adopted a strategy significantly lower than the market average, signaling that the industry is rapidly entering an era of low-margin competition. The management expense ratio for both new ETFs was set at 0.14%, a figure that is not only lower than that of Grayscale Mini Ethereum Trust (0.15%) and Franklin Templeton's SOL ETF SOEZ (0.19%) but also far below the typical 0.20%-0.25% range for traditional spot Bitcoin ETFs. As expense ratios across the board decline, pure passive price-tracking products find it increasingly difficult to maintain high profit margins. Issuers are now competing for liquidity by reducing expenses, pushing the entire industry toward deeper structural innovation where fee compression is a defensive tactic rather than a primary value proposition.

Structurally, the integration of staking mechanisms within the regulatory framework serves as the key differentiator for these products. In its S-1 registration filing submitted to the SEC, Morgan Stanley disclosed its income generation approach in a legally binding manner: the Ethereum trust plan allocates 50% to 80% of its ETH holdings for staking, while the SOL trust allows up to 100% of its SOL holdings to be used for network validation. The fund partners with professional node service providers such as Figment and Coinbase Canada, with operators charging only 5% of the staking rewards as service fees. By structuring staking rights as trusts in compliant filings, institutional capital can directly benefit from the staking rewards of crypto networks through legitimate channels, ensuring that most of these rewards are smoothly converted into the fund's net value.

Woofun AI data shows that the resulting yield calculations create a compound internal cash flow that significantly boosts overall returns. Based on current public chain benchmarks, the annualized yield from basic Ethereum staking is around 2.7%, while that for SOL staking ranges from 5% to 7%. After deducting 5% for node service fees and 0.14% for ETF management fees, this results in an additional annualized net return of approximately 2.4% (for ETH) and 5% (for SOL). This model, which combines upward price appreciation expectations with fixed interest, challenges traditional financial perspectives on pricing crypto assets. The conversion of these yields into the overall fund net value represents a significant shift from pure capital gains to a hybrid income model.

Capital flows provide the most sensitive indicator of this structural shift, with the consensus among institutions to allocate funds solely to Bitcoin beginning to weaken. Market data confirms this trend: during trading on July 23, spot Bitcoin ETFs experienced a daily net outflow of $225 million, while Ethereum ETFs saw growth on the same day, with a net inflow of $26.32 million. Such capital movements send a clear market signal that as compliant asset classes expand, professional funds are balancing their risk exposure by shifting from single Bitcoin positions to diversified crypto asset portfolios. This migration reflects a broader institutional desire to optimize returns through assets that offer more than just beta exposure.

The regulatory endorsement of non-Bitcoin crypto assets further solidifies this trend, removing legal barriers to including mainstream public chain assets in portfolios. Although Bitwise's BSOL has been available in the market with current assets under management of around $600 million, the involvement of a traditional Wall Street giant like Morgan Stanley carries far greater significance. The SEC's approval of its SOL spot ETF means that regulators have provided a deeper legal endorsement for non-Bitcoin crypto assets as compliant investment targets. This subtle shift in regulatory attitude indicates that the staking mechanism is evolving from an early regulatory no-go zone to a standardized template for future product issuance, where disclosure is properly managed rather than prohibited.

Notably, the implications for arbitrage and liquidity are profound, as spot ETFs with staking income components reshape the micro market structures of Ethereum and SOL. In traditional basis arbitrage, quantitative firms must now account for staking income as an opportunity cost of capital. If ETFs can generate annual returns of 3% to 7%, higher premiums will be required on the futures side to cover this cost and attract arbitrageurs.

Additionally, thanks to Morgan Stanley's extensive brokerage network, including full coverage by ETRADE for related trades, the influx of new capital will significantly narrow the bid-ask spread. This improvement in liquidity, combined with changes in the basis structure, requires high-frequency and quantitative teams to recalibrate their existing arbitrage parameters to remain profitable.

A more critical variable is the risk profile associated with these income-generating assets, as pursuing yield is not without costs. Investors who enjoy these returns are also exposed to tail risks associated with underlying public chains, including failures of validator nodes, slashing penalties that can result in substantial losses of principal, and delays in unstaking during extreme market conditions. It is particularly important to note that SOL's historical volatility and downtime frequency are objectively higher than those of Ethereum. The relatively high staking yield of around 7% is, in financial terms, essentially a risk premium compensating for the higher network risks. Before heavily investing in such assets, these non-systemic risks must be included in stress tests under extreme market conditions to ensure that risk-adjusted returns remain favorable compared to absolute returns from traditional holdings.

This shift signals a move from speculation to asset management. If previous spot Bitcoin ETFs were like renting an extremely secure vault on Wall Street to store gold—where investors could only wait for price fluctuations to earn profits, even paying storage fees—then Ethereum and SOL ETFs with staking income are more like purchasing a shop in a prime digital business district: allowing investors to benefit from rising property values while also receiving regular rent from network operations.

This composite model of beta exposure plus internal cash flow is breaking away from institutional capital's reliance on Bitcoin alone. For professional asset management firms, this proven regulatory framework has pushed crypto investing from a simple game of price speculation to a more mature stage of asset management. Of course, there are no free lunches; as investors enter this new realm filled with inherent interest, keeping an eye on risks such as slashing and downtime in underlying networks remains an essential safety threshold for everyone.
